🌅 Your Morning Nervous System Ritual — 10 Minutes That Can Change Your Entire Day Most people wake up and immediately enter survival mode… phone notifications, rushing, caffeine, chaos. But your first 10 minutes after waking decide your mood, focus, energy, and stress levels for the entire day. Your nervous system acts like a switch — and how you start your morning determines whether that switch is in stress mode or clarity mode. Here’s a simple, science-backed ritual to regulate your nervous system and align your biology with peak performance ⬇️ ✨ 1. Natural Light Exposure Step outside for 2–10 minutes. Morning light resets your circadian rhythm, boosts mood, balances cortisol, and improves tonight’s sleep. Even cloudy light works. ✨ 2. Gentle Movement Stretch, sway, dance, shake, or walk for 2–3 minutes. Movement discharges stored stress and wakes up your body naturally. ✨ 3. Hydration First Drink a big glass of water with a pinch of sea salt or electrolytes. This supports adrenal health, reduces fatigue, and restores your system after 7–8 hours of dehydration. ✨ 4. Delay Caffeine Let your natural cortisol peak first. Waiting until after 9AM reduces anxiety, prevents afternoon crashes, and helps you sleep better at night. ✨ 5. Nervous System Supports Cold splash, humming, self-massage, gratitude, or intention setting. Avoid phone/news — protect your mind before the world enters. This routine works with your biology, not against it.
